chinquapin; chinkapin; Castanopsis tree
Refers to any tree of the genus Castanopsis, commonly called chinquapin or chinkapin in English. The word is usually written in kana.
Chinquapin nuts are edible.
There is a large chinquapin tree in the park.

Hiragana spelling is standard for this word.
Katakana spelling, often used in botanical contexts or field guides.
Kanji form; usually written in kana. The kanji 椎 is also used for つい (spine) and しい (chinquapin), but kana is preferred for this tree name.
Native Japanese word. The kanji 椎 is a Chinese character used for similar trees, but the Japanese reading しい is not derived from Chinese.
